Transaction 1428062a17d98a891df42659e4fcb21587f04d29bb77bb696001784589c01b2b
1 Input
1 Output
-
1428062a17d98a891df42659e4fcb21587f04d29bb77bb696001784589c01b2b:0
- value
- 8545
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cac6ece9e6ff33fffe08ba80598a83f0750cda2
- address
- bc1q8jkxan57dlenlllq3w5qtx9g8ur4pndzue8g4z